Ginnes K John is Assistant Professor (stage 2) in the Department of Electrical and Electronics Engineering at Rajagiri School of Engineering and Technology (RSET), Kochi. He obtained B.Tech degree in Electrical and Electronics Engineering from M.A.College of Engineering, Kothamangalam, Mahatma Gandhi University, Kerala in the year 2005. He received M.Tech in Power Electronics from Amrita University, Coimbatore in the year 2008 and currently he is a research scholar (part time) in the same university. He has been teaching both undergraduate and post graduate students since 2009.

He joined RSET on 3rd January 2011.

He has published a number of papers in national & international journals and conferences.

His areas of interest includes Power Electronics, Power Quality, Smart Grid, Microgrid and Electrical Drives.

He has co-authored book on "Power Electronics Laboratory Manual - Design, Testing and Simulation" by CBS Publishers & Distributors in the year 2017.

He has also co-authored a book on Fundamentals of Electrical Machines and Drives, by Elsevier in the year 2014 and re-published by Cengage Learning, in the year 2016.
